Panel issues are the heartbeat of many problems

Most major faults trace back to or through the electrical panel. In homes constructed from the 1950s through the early 1980s, service sizes ran from 60 to 125 amps. That was great for a house without an electrical variety, EV, or heatpump. Today, in between EV charging, induction ranges, and hot tubs, panels require headroom. If your main breaker is 100 amps and the panel is loaded with tandem breakers to squeeze in one more circuit, it is time to talk about an electrical panel upgrade in Orange County.

An appropriate panel replacement in Orange County follows a tight schedule. We perform a load estimation to see what the home really requires, size the service appropriately, verify with the utility whether the drop and meter base can support it, pull the authorization, and collaborate the cut-over day. In lots of cities, the inspector will sign the panel the exact same day and the utility will perform a meter set or release within 24 to 72 hours. With careful planning, a property owner experiences only a few hours without power. If the panel reveals heat damage or deterioration, we set a short-term solution to keep vital loads running, then complete the upgrade the next day. The secret is not just swapping metal for metal, however ensuring grounding and bonding are correct, neutrals and premises are separated properly in subpanels, and breakers match the noted panel series.

I have opened panels in Anaheim Hills that looked fine on the outside but hid a neutral bus with half the screws loose. Tightening, cleansing, and applying antioxidant on aluminum service conductors while the service is de-energized fixed periodic dimming that had afflicted the home for months. That is the type of fix that pays for itself in peace of mind.

EV charger setup, done right the first time

Requests for EV charger setup in Orange County outpace nearly every other single service. Level 2 circuits typically land at 40 or 50 amps, with the battery charger set to 32 or 40 amps continuous. Post 625 of the NEC deals with EV charging as a constant load, so the 80 percent guideline applies. That means a 40 amp circuit ought to feed a battery charger set no higher than 32 amps. Numerous house owners set the amperage in the app and forget that their panel needs to support the real, not theoretical, draw.

We start with a load calculation that includes a/c, range, dryer, and existing circuits, then propose the cleanest run to the garage or driveway. For attached garages, the run might be short. For separated or far side wall installs, we plan for attic or crawl area routing and a weatherproof exterior segment. Some prefer a hardwired electric lorry charger in Orange County to prevent cord-and-plug derating, others desire a NEMA 14-50 for versatility. Either is great if the wire size, breaker rating, and GFCI requirements are met. Where a panel upgrade looms, we can frequently set a momentary lower current limit on the charger for exact same day use, then return for the complete electrical panel upgrade once the permit clears.

Lighting, comfort, and the information that separate a neat job from a messy one

Lighting installation in Orange County runs the gamut from easy flush installs to full recessed lighting strategies. The greatest variable is the home's construction. In a 1990s tract home with open attic space, we can typically include 6 to 8 recessed cans in a living-room without opening the drywall, patching only little switch box cut-ins. In older homes with lath and plaster ceilings in the City of Orange, fishing wire requires more perseverance and better protection for the finished surface areas. The right recessed lighting in Orange County uses shallow cans where required, LED modules with high color making, and dimmers matched to the driver type to prevent ghosting or flicker.

Ceiling fan setup in Orange County brings two repeating risks, boxes that are not fan ranked, and switch loops wired in ways that puzzle wise controls. We replace package with a fan-rated unit, validate assistance from structure, and, if the client desires independent light and fan control, pull an extra conductor or install a suitable cordless control. For outdoor lighting in Orange County, the coastal air will discover cheap hardware. I encourage marine grade or a minimum of stainless fixtures and proper sealing of all splices in listed enclosures with gel-filled adapters to keep rust from creeping in.

Smart home circuitry in Orange County is not almost expensive switches. It has to do with solid low voltage electrical wiring that does not battle your Wi-Fi. We install Cat6 drops to office, ceilings for access points, and out to cams, use PoE where suitable, and plan avenue to crucial areas so future devices do not imply tearing walls. Low voltage electrical wiring in Orange County likewise covers doorbells, thermostats, and landscape lighting transformers. When run easily and labeled, it saves hours on future service calls.

Generators and backup, practical choices that pass inspection

Generator setup in Orange County typically burglarizes two paths. For house owners who desire peace of mind for a fridge, lights, and web throughout short interruptions, a generator inlet and an interlock set at the panel is expense efficient. You roll the portable unit out, plug in, and power picked circuits safely. This requires a listed interlock, a correct inlet, and a means to separate the utility feed so no backfeed occurs. For those who want whole house coverage without lifting a finger, a standby generator with an automated transfer switch is the answer. That includes coordination with gas https://andrezjxi660.bearsfanteamshop.com/outlet-installation-orange-county-gfci-usb-and-more supply sizing, a concrete pad, and HOA or city clearance for sound and placement. A good Orange County electrical contractor will size loads truthfully, not oversell wattage, and will pull the right permits so your electrical inspection in Orange County is smooth.

Troubleshooting is an art that appreciates the clock

Speed originates from pattern recognition more than from racing through steps. Electrical troubleshooting in Orange County frequently returns to the very same culprits. Shared neutrals causing odd voltage readings, back-stabbed receptacle connections failing under load, improperly noted dimmers on LED retrofits, and bad terminations in outside boxes after years of salt air. The trick is to show each theory with a measurement or a test, not hunch alone. That is how same day repair work remain reliable 6 months later.

I keep in mind a Laguna Niguel call where kitchen lights pulsed each time the microwave ran. The panel looked fine. The breaker was not tripping. The problem traced to a loose neutral splice buried in a junction box above the cooking area, most likely disrupted during a remodel a years prior. Ten minutes with a toner discovered the box, and a clean wirenut and pigtail repaired what months of frustration had actually turned mysterious. That is what you pay a certified electrical expert in Orange County for, not guesswork however a method.

Case snapshots that reveal what very same day looks like

A restaurant in Tustin called at 7 a.m. The espresso device would not power up, and doors opened at 8. We discovered a 20 amp circuit with a weak connection in the undercounter receptacle, heat stressed however not yet failed. We replaced the device with an industrial specification unit, moved the mill to a different circuit to balance the load, and had the device steaming by 7:45. A small reconfiguration avoided a bigger service call down the line.

A home in Dana Point had landscape lights popping the transformer breaker at random. The house owner switched bulbs and reset the timer a dozen times. The offender was a set of corroded splice caps inside a watering box. We replaced the splices with gel-filled adapters, raised the connections out of the water course, and reset the load taps for even voltage drop. That lawn has actually been glowing ever since, and the transformer runs cooler.

A household in Irvine installed an electrical car battery charger with a handyman's assistance. The charger was set to 48 amps on a 50 amp breaker, with wire one size too small for the run length. It worked fine on cool nights, then tripped on hot afternoons. We adjusted the charger to 40 amps, changed the run with the correct conductor size, and recorded the load calc for the house owner's records. That very same day correction protected the equipment warranty and prevented future nuisance trips.
